Early day motion · EDM 1191 · 14 Mar 2013
CHILDREN IN POVERTY AND FREE SCHOOL MEALS
Tabled by George Galloway (Workers Party of Britain)
15 signatures
The motion
That this House is shocked by the statistic that around 700,000 school-age children living in poverty are not receiving free school meals; congratulates the Children's Society for revealing this shameful state of affairs; notes that many working parents below the poverty line are discriminated against by being denied this crucial health benefit for their children because they are employed; further notes that a single parent working for 16 hours a week and a couple working 24 hours, both on working tax credit, cannot qualify, however poor they may be; and calls on the Government to ensure that all school-age children living in poverty receive free school meals whether or not their parents have jobs.
